Create an Account - Increase your productivity, customize your experience, and engage in information you care about.
P.O. Box 8181Hillsborough, NC 27278
2501 Homestead RoadChapel Hill, NC 27516
919-245-2490
919-969-3018
300 W Tryon StreetThird FloorHillsborough, NC 27278
919-644-3056